Scarlet Runner Beans
I had a wonderful crop of Scarlet Runner Beans this year.
My first planting is nearly over and I am leaving the rest of them on the vine to make seed for next year seeing as they are an heirloom. My first seed-saving.
My second planting, and in a different spot, is still yielding about a pound of beans a day. I have frozen several pounds of beans in single portion quantities, enough for many an addition to meals in the coming winter, meanwhile I am eating and sharing as many as I can while they last.
Definately a crop for me to plant next year, but with a different set-up of trellis so that I can reach them without using a step-ladder. Also I wil use housecloth to keep the voles away, otherwise this year I would have had three trellises of beans.

Re: Scarlet Runner Beans
Kelejan,
I grew scarlett runner beans for the first time this year and did not know they have sort of furry skins on the beans.
Do you cook them the same as any other garden green bean? I just picked some yeterday and have not cooked them yet.
